Definition of Ultra High Net Worth Individual

The concept of ultra high net worth individuals (UHNWIs) has its roots in the early 21st century, when the global economy experienced an unprecedented level of growth and asset accumulation. The term “ultra high net worth” was coined to describe individuals whose net worth exceeds $30 million, a threshold that has been continually adjusted to reflect the ever-increasing wealth gap.
In the early 2000s, the number of UHNWIs was largely concentrated in the realm of private equity and real estate investing, but as the global economy evolved, the demographics and industries driving wealth creation have expanded to encompass technology, finance, and entrepreneurship.

Determining Net Worth: Methods and Applications
Determining an individual’s net worth involves quantifying their total worth by summing up all their liquid and illiquid assets, including but not limited to; cash, stocks, bonds, real estate, private equity investments, and retirement savings. In the context of ultra high net worth individuals, net worth is often estimated through a combination of publicly disclosed data such as financial reports, business publications, and publicly traded company holdings.
These estimates are then used to classify individuals as ultra high net worth, a designation that affords them access to exclusive investment opportunities, financial services, and networks.

Tax-Efficient Planning, What is a ultra high net worth individual
When it comes to managing vast wealth, tax efficiency plays a crucial role in maximizing returns and minimizing liabilities. Savvy UHNWIs often employ various tax strategies, including gift tax planning, charitable donations, and foreign trust structures, to optimize their financial situation. These techniques can help reduce tax burdens, allowing individuals to direct more money towards their investments and financial goals.* Tax-Efficient Charitable Giving: UHNWIs can create charitable trusts, foundations, or donor-advised funds to support their philanthropic efforts while minimizing taxes.
By leveraging tax deductions and exemptions, they can make a significant impact without depleting their wealth.* Foreign Trust Structures: Utilizing foreign trust structures can provide tax benefits, especially for UHNWIs with global assets. By creating a foreign trust, individuals can shield their assets from domestic taxes and take advantage of more favorable tax regimes in other countries.* Gift Tax Planning: Strategic gift planning allows UHNWIs to transfer wealth to future generations while minimizing gift taxes.
By structuring gifts effectively, they can reduce the tax burden and ensure their wealth is protected for the long term.

Recommended Investment Vehicles and Strategies
To achieve their long-term financial goals, UHNWIs often employ a range of investment vehicles and strategies tailored to their risk tolerance and objectives.* Private Equity and Venture Capital: Investing in private equity and venture capital can provide UHNWIs with the opportunity to participate in high-growth companies and industries. This type of investment can offer significant returns, but it also comes with added risks and complexities.* Alternative Investments: UHNWIs often allocate a portion of their portfolio to alternative investments, such as real estate, art, and collectibles.
These assets can provide a unique blend of cash flow, capital appreciation, and diversification benefits.* Impact Investing: Some UHNWIs choose to invest in impact investing, which aims to generate both financial returns and positive social or environmental impact. By supporting companies and projects that address pressing global challenges, UHNWIs can align their investments with their values and contribute to a more sustainable future.

Popular Questions
What sets ultra high net worth individuals apart from high net worth individuals?
Ultra high net worth individuals have a net worth exceeding $30 million, whereas high net worth individuals have a net worth between $1 million and $30 million.
How do ultra high net worth individuals typically accumulate their wealth?
They often achieve their wealth through a combination of strategic investments, shrewd business deals, and inheritance.
